Árvore de páginas

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.

Tempo aproximado para leitura: 00 min


01. DADOS GERAIS

Linha de Produto:Microsiga Protheus
Segmento:Varejo
Módulo:Controle de Lojas (SIGALOJA)
Função:LOJA140 - Cancelamento
Ticket:4232795
Requisito/Story/Issue (informe o requisito relacionado) :DVARLOJ4-1869
Fontes do Pacote:LOJA140.PRX  09/01/2019


02. SITUAÇÃO/REQUISITO

Nas vendas canceladas com ECF e TEF, se o Gerenciador do TEF era encerrado ou ocorria perda de conexão antes de finalizar o cancelamento do TEF; a venda ficava cancelada no ECF e aberta no Protheus e no TEF causando inconsistências entre SFI e SF2

03. SOLUÇÃO

Inserida na rotina de Cancelamento de Venda (LOJA140) com emissão de cupom fiscal (uso de ECF), trava o tratamento para que ao cancelar uma venda TEF não permita sair do cancelamento enquanto o pagamento em cartão não seja cancelado.

Totvs custom tabs box
tabsPasso 01, Passo 02, Passo 03, Passo 04
idspasso1,passo2

fique tentando comunicar com o Gerenciador do TEF e assim, enviar o cancelamento da venda em cartão.

Será efetuada a tentativa de comunicação/cancelamento por um determinado numero de vezes e ao fim das tentativas, será emitida mensagem se deseja tentar comunicar ou prossegue sem o cancelamento do TEF.

Caso seja selecionado continuar sem o cancelamento do TEF, será necessário efetuar o cancelamento via rotina "Rotinas TEF" senão haverá a divergência entre Protheus e Gerenciador Padrão do TEF.

04. DEMAIS INFORMAÇÕES

VIDE no próprio TDN para busca de maiores informações

Totvs custom tabs box items
defaultyes
referenciapasso1
Totvs custom tabs box items
defaultno
referenciapasso2

04. DEMAIS INFORMAÇÕES

Card documentosInformacaoUse esse box para destacar informações relevantes e/ou de destaque.TituloIMPORTANTE!

05. ASSUNTOS RELACIONADOS


Templatedocumentos


HTML
<style>
div.theme-default .ia-splitter #main {
    margin-left: 0px;
}
.ia-fixed-sidebar, .ia-splitter-left {
    display: none;
}
#main {
    padding-left: 10px;
    padding-right: 10px;
    overflow-x: hidden;
}

.aui-header-primary .aui-nav,  .aui-page-panel {
    margin-left: 0px !important;
}
.aui-header-primary .aui-nav {
    margin-left: 0px !important;
}
</style>